Braking

Electric scooter brakes operate differently than the brakes on bicycles or cars. The brake disc or rotor is attached to the wheel and controlled by a part known as the caliper. When you press the brake lever the caliper squeezes the brake pads onto the rotor, creating friction that slows the wheel. Depending on how fast you drive and how often you use your brakes, they might need to be replaced or serviced from time to time.

When riding a scooter, it is essential to keep in mind that you must not take your feet off the pedals when they are in use. Keep your feet on the brake pedals to control the speed, especially when you approach an intersection with a pedestrian crossing or stop sign.

When you brake on a scooter, it's recommended to apply equal pressure to the rear and front brakes. This will prevent you from causing the front wheel to become locked and allows the rear wheel to pick up the slack and actually begin slowing down. It also helps keep you balanced and to not over-insert the brakes on either side of your vehicle.

Regenerative braking is an additional characteristic of some scooters. This system helps to extend the range of your scooter by recapturing energy from stopping and putting it back into the battery. This system works differently depending on the type of scooter you have but generally involves an electric motor that is activated through an lever or throttle.

Regenerative braking can be an effective way to reduce the cost of fuel. However, it's important to remember that you shouldn't make use of it as your primary brake. The reason is that the brakes that regeneratively braking recover only the energy of a certain amount and does not produce the same amount of braking force as regular brakes. It is also not as effective at stopping wheel skidding and should only be used in emergencies.
